The defining feature of the F-14 is its "swing wing" mechanism. Depending on the complexity of your template, the wings may be fixed in one position, or they may utilize an interlocking paper pivot system that allows them to sweep back and forth. If constructing a functional wing mechanism, reinforce the pivot points with extra layers of cardstock to withstand the friction of movement. One of the biggest "tells" of a paper model is the white line visible at every seam. Take a felt-tip marker that matches the jet’s gray or blue paint and lightly run it along the cut edge of the paper before gluing. This makes the seams virtually disappear. Master the Curves
